PROCEDURE:
1. REMOVE CONTENTS FROM BOX. VERIFY ALL PARTS ARE PRESENT. READ INSTRUCTIONS CAREFULLY BEFORE STARTING INSTALLATION.
2. From underside of vehicle, remove factory tow hooks if equipped. NOTE: Tow hooks may not
be mounted in conjunction with the Grille Guard. If vehicle is not equipped with factory tow hooks, cutout the sections of the bumper intake as shown in Figure 1.
3. Starting on the driver side of the vehicle, remove the two bottom factory nuts located at the front of the frame rail and the factory bolt near the front end of frame rail (Figure 2)
4. Attach driver side Frame Bracket to vehicle using the factory bolt and nuts removed in step three (Figure 3). Fully tighten at this time.
5. Insert driver side Grille Guard Bracket through front of tow hook cavity or cutout cavity, then partially hang it from already installed Frame Bracket using the included (2) 12mm x 35mm Hex Head Bolts, (2) 12mm Lock Washers, (2) 12mm Hex Nuts, and (4) 12mm Flat Washers
(Figure 4). Do not tighten at this time.
6. Repeat steps 3 – 5 for passenger side Lower Mounting Brackets.
7. Locate the two factory bolts on each side of the radiator support. Remove the outside bolt on each side of the radiator support (Figure 5).
8. Open the hood and slide Top Brackets through gap between the front bumper and the radiator
support (Figure 6). Align Top Brackets with previously removed factory bolt mounting locations. Secure Top Brackets to vehicle using the factory bolts removed in step seven
(Figure 7).
9. With help position Grille Guard on the outside of Grille Guard Brackets. Use the included (4)
12mm x 35mm Hex Head Bolts, (4) 12mm Lock Washers, (4) 12mm Hex Nuts, and (8) 12mm Flat Washers (Figure 8 & 9). Do not tighten at this time.
10. Attach Grille Guard to Top Brackets using the included (2) 10mm x 25mm Button Bolts, (2) 10mm Lock Washers, (2) 10mm Hex Nuts, and (8) 10mm Flat Washers (Figure 10).
11. Adjust Grille Guard properly; and then tighten all hardware at this time.
12. Do periodic inspections to the installation to make sure that all hardware is secure and tight.
To protect your investment, wax this product after installing. Regular waxing is recommended to
add a protective layer over the finish. Do not use any type of polish or wax that may contain abrasives that could damage the finish. For stainless steel: Aluminum polish may be used to polish small scratches and scuffs on the finish. Mild soap may be used also to clean the Grille Guard.
For gloss black finishes: Mild soap may be used to clean the Grille Guard.
